About

Google Analytics is Alphabet's (NASDAQ: GOOGL) free web and app analytics platform — the world's most widely deployed digital analytics tool, installed on 50%+ of all websites globally — providing marketers, analysts, and developers with traffic measurement, user behavior analysis, conversion tracking, and audience insights for websites and mobile applications. Google Analytics 4 (GA4), launched in 2020 and replacing Universal Analytics in 2023, represents a fundamental architectural shift from session-based measurement to event-based data modeling, enabling cross-device and cross-platform tracking as the modern web's cookie deprecation and mobile app proliferation require.

About

Apache Cassandra is an open-source distributed NoSQL database management system designed for handling massive amounts of structured data across commodity servers, offering high availability, fault tolerance, and linear horizontal scalability with no single point of failure. Originally developed at Facebook in 2007 (to power the Facebook Inbox search feature), Cassandra was open-sourced in 2008 and became an Apache Software Foundation project in 2010. The technology is widely deployed at scale-intensive companies including Discord, Netflix, Apple, Uber, and Instagram.
